Can You Buy Wine With Food Stamps?

No, wine is not one of the approved products for which you may use your food stamps.

While this may appear to some to be unjust, the regulation is in place for a purpose. Food stamps, or EBT cards as they are currently known, are designed to provide monthly financial assistance for healthy food to low-income families.

Wine may be deemed edible, or better put, drinkable, but it is not vital or nutritious enough to be included on the list of items on which you can spend your monthly allotment and food stamps.

Is this true for all alcoholic drinks?

Yes, all alcoholic beverages are forbidden, and you are not permitted to purchase them with your EBT card.

This includes, in addition to wine, the following:

  • Beer
  • Liquor
  • Spirit
  • Malt

Does this include all stores that accept food stamps?

Yes, you cannot buy alcohol with your EBT card at any business that accepts food stamps.

This is also true for any other place that accepts EBT cards and sells alcohol, such as:

  • Liquor stores;
  • Wineries;
  • Or alcohol sales

You can buy alcoholic beverages while shopping for things that will be paid for with food stamps, but you must separate the items and arrange another form of payment.

What Can’t You Get With An EBT Card?

Products containing alcohol, such as wine and other alcoholic beverages, are not permitted to be purchased, but there are more items like:

  • Tobacco
  • Cigarettes
  • Diapers
  • Dog and cat food
  • Paper products
  • Cosmetics
  • Vitamins
